Conservation and the Environmental Connection
When discussing the Big Butterfly in astrology, the conservation efforts and environmental elements play a significant role. The focus is on preserving natural habitats and recognizing butterflies, such as the monarch, as key indicators of ecosystem health.
Protecting Butterfly Habitats
Efforts to safeguard butterfly habitats are crucial for maintaining the biodiversity that underpins healthy ecosystems. For example, conservationists actively establish butterfly gardens that provide food and reproductive sites for the monarch butterfly. These gardens are essential for supporting their migratory patterns, which in turn affects various ecosystems across states.
Butterflies as Environmental Indicators
Butterflies offer valuable insight into the state of our environment. Their sensitivity to alterations in their habitat makes them excellent indicators of environmental change. By studying butterfly populations and movements, especially of species like the monarch, scientists can infer the health of habitats and, by extension, the bigger environmental picture.
